Spoke with Morbus a few weeks back, and as Coder Tough Love has not been actively maintained for quite some time (and with no plans to update it), I'd recommend we remove the related dependency from PIFR_Coder and take the coder_tough_love argument out of the coder tests listing. (Also, the coder tough love standards may be considered a little too strict to include them in advisory coder reviews.)
